SERP494D - Educational Interpreting Experience (Practicum III)

Disability & Psychoed StudiesUndergraduateUA - UA General

Course ID

041745

Course Description

During practicum III, all efforts will be made to place students in K-12 settings with a professional educational interpreter as a mentor for 90 hours of interpreting experience. Supervising interpreters will provide the student ongoing, informal feedback and will provide the practicum instructor written feedback on the student during the semester (SERP 494D). Students will meet with practicum instructor and other students weekly to discuss interpreting experiences (SERP 497D). An instructor will observe students at least once during the semester. At the end of the semester, students will take a formal EIPA evaluation.
